About this role

Dematic is seeking a Project Manager to oversee various projects of significant magnitude in terms of complexity, cost, time-constraints, internal and external staffing, and equipment including software and hardware.

This role requires 50%+ travel in the United States.

In this role, you'll provide direction to project team including assignment of individual responsibilities, tasks and technical functions and manage a project within the triple constraints of scope, schedule, and budget.

Tasks and Qualifications:

What You Will Do In This Role:

  • Identify and manage project risks with actionable mitigation strategies.

  • Analyze project profitability forecasts appropriate monthly costs for revenue recognition and ensures timely and accurate invoicing.

  • Provide Project Management Practices and Solution Development Leadership to the Pre-Sales efforts in accordance with pre-sales processes.

  • Must have knowledge of the constraints and methods for defining and demonstrating equipment, subsystem, and system performance criteria.

  • Ability to develop detailed project schedules inclusive of all in-scope engineering, installation, and integration schedule activities as well as explicit and implicate out-of-scope milestones by others (i.e. owners and general contractors) impacting project execution.

  • Apply base principles of systems engineering in the project execution efforts and in pre-sales solution development efforts which includes: - Develop and validate the customer’s business case.

  • Develop proposal, estimate, high level schedule.
     

What We Are Looking For:

  • Bachelors Degree in Business or Engineering (preferred).

  • Minimum 3-5 years' experience in material handling industry.

  • Excellent interpersonal, organizational and communication skills.

  • Strong Project Management background.

  • Team leadership and facilitation skills.

  • Proficiency in MS Office and MS Projects.
